Job Ref: JO-2506-65392_1754897947
Salary: £45,772.89 per annum
Contract type: Permanent
Location Thornton - Post code FY7
Working hours: Average 37.8 hours per week, 12 hour shifts, 5 shift system, 24/7
6am - 6pm / 6pm - 6am - 2 days, 2 nights on 7 cycles followed by an 18day break.
Roles and responsibilities:
- Maintenance of the waste treatment facility assets and associated infrastructure, including operational monitoring of functional odour abatement systems and the SCADA system.
- Fault Finding and repairs
Required Skills / Qualifications Required:
- Recognised apprenticeship in relevant discipline (Electrical and Electronics
Engineering) to ONC/HNC Level
- Ability to effectively manage work schedules in a timely manner
- Provide evidence of working to deadlines and under pressure
- Evidence of working in an organised manner
- Evidence of using effective problem-solving techniques
- Effective communicator at all levels both written and verbally.
- Detailed knowledge of preventative, predictive and lifecycle maintenance activities.
Desirable Skills
- Knowledge of the Waste processing industry
- Detailed knowledge of waste processing plant, machinery and associated systems or FMCG Chemical and industrial industries.
- Knowledge of working with CMMS software applications
- Knowledge of Siemens systems
Company benefits:
- Pension matched up to 5%
- Death in service cover at 4 times basic salary
- Free on-site car parking.
- Company sick pay scheme- up to 20 weeks dependent on length of service, rising to 26 weeks from 1st January 2025.
- Cycle to work scheme.
- Training and personal development programmes available to provide opportunities to develop and progress.
- Wellbeing support for mental health.
- All required PPE and other relevant equipment supplied.
